  • I had stressful night with them. Trust me, I do my nails regularly and this was by far the bizarre experience I had with them. I asked for Shellac price and they said $25. I thought, 'Wow, great price, is that because it's in suburb?' (I usually do my nails in downtown near my work). So I went. Apparently, $25 is just for the colour! Normally, when I go to any other nail salon, they usually quote the full service price (with removing cuticles, shaping and massage the hand and arm at the end). In full, it was $35, which was actually even more expensive than my downtown one I go. My cuticles weren't so bad so I let it go. Then the colouring. Holy shit. that was the worse brush work I ever seen in my 'nail salon' life! the colour wasn't evened out, and I can see the 2nd layer brush work, 3rd layer brush work, and there was visible streaks! I think I could have done better job with my left hand than this woman! They don't "clean" or wipe the place so the nail filing dust sits on the nail and she just paint it over. I could see the bumps. Even more, I was amazed because she was already putting "top coat" when she knew it wasn't good. Great work ethics! She glued my skin to my nail so much that she had to yank-it and filing it rough- i thought she was carving my flesh out. LOL And also, she colour on top of the cuticle that wasn't groomed and I was like WTF? Aren't they suppose not to go over the cuticle?! I was complaining to the owner and first she said "It's very hard to control with Shellac" Are you kidding me!?! ISn't it WHY I"M PAYING YOU TO DO MY NAILS!?!!? then she said having coat over the uncleaned cuticle will make the colour stay longer. Are you kidding me?!? What's wrong with you!!?! Seriously they ruined my evening. The owner was trying to "fix" it, but I didn't want to risk my nails with these ppl especially for shellac. She did take off all the damage the other girl did. She went MAD when I told her I want to go instead of letting her to re-do the job. My nails were already damaged enough from scrapping the whole thing out. Plus, what's the guarantee that you will do better job than her? I don't think so. Pick the salon wisely people especially when you are not doing normal manicure. She was bragging about her 17 years of experience with regular customers coming, but lady, I got better nail salon quality from other place than yours. Trust me. and... what she said really hit the final pissing me off contest. she was saying how she pays rent and stuff and how she work so hard in demanding tone (insinuating that I should pay even though the other girl ruined my nails and whole freakin' show)... which I got truly offended.... We all work hard for our money!!! You think your money is hard earned money and my money grow on tree!?! Don't even bring up your money problem when you don't even know me.
